Understanding Your $24/hr Salary in Nebraska

At $24 per hour working 40 hours a week, your gross annual salary is $49,920. After federal and Nebraska taxes, you bring home approximately $39,910 per year, or $3,326 per month.

Tax Breakdown for Nebraska

Nebraska uses progressive tax brackets, with rates ranging from 2.5% to 5.2%.
